你查询的IP:[123.206.210.132]  地理位置:中国–上海–上海

最新查询58.66.100.201 219.82.189.12 220.154.3.68 121.58.19.144 124.47.147.194 116.76.90.226 58.24.46.63 123.112.2.83 124.31.100.113 123.206.210.132 116.8.236.201 117.100.132.112 119.254.238.66 203.142.219.49 60.253.128.0 125.98.50.213 202.160.176.184 203.100.32.217 119.32.229.247 202.96.228.44 118.120.34.141 118.64.72.254 222.126.128.61 119.164.242.24 202.60.112.241 117.121.192.229 210.56.192.158 124.156.198.201 119.2.114.139 123.49.128.63 60.255.125.40